What do franchise brokers do?

MSA Worldwide

But keep in mind that brokers are paid a commission – and earn income – only when you buy a franchise from one of their clients. In some situations franchise brokers may continue to earn a percentage of your payments to the franchisor if you invest in additional franchises later.
